These days, finding an affordable place to live in the Ritner area can be challenging. Home prices in Ritner are now at a median cost of $71,072, lower than the Kentucky average of $164,895.
The average cost of rent is $593/mo in Ritner, primarily driven by the current value of real estate in the Ritner area. While nearly 57.69% of residents own their homes outright in Ritner, 9.59% rent.
Housing affordability isn’t just about home prices, though. The average household income in Ritner is $2,492 per month. Households that rent pay about 23.81% of their income on rent here. Ritner's most expensive areas are in the central regions, while the cheapest areas are in the western parts of the city.
